Beaver vs Kearns metro township, Utah

Side-by-side comparison

How does Beaver, UT compare to Kearns metro township, Utah, UT? Beaver has a population of 3,632 with a median household income of $82,625, while Kearns metro township, Utah has 37,058 residents and a median income of $83,355.
